Am Dienstag, 10. April 2012 schrieb Steve Beattie:
> I couldn't find an option to pod2man to turn emitting anything to =

> stderr into an error, much to Christian's disappointment, I'm sure.

Ok, you wanted it, so you'll get it ;-)

If pod2man writes to stderr, making that fatal is easy:

pod2main --stderr [... other options ...]   2>pod2man-errors
test ! -s pod2man-errors || { cat pod2man-errors ; exit 1 ; }

I'll let it up to you to implement this in the Makefile. =

Don't forget to delete pod2man-errors in make clean ;-)
